

The Battlefords River Valley, located between the City of North Battleford and the Town of Battleford is a picture perfect place to hike, ski, photograph wildlife or wild flowers or just spend time gazing at the panoramic view.
Created by glaciation and continually changing by the constant wear and tear of the North Saskatchewan and Battle Rivers, this valley is one of the most picturesque landscapes in the province. The valley is rich in both natural and cultural history waiting to be explored.
Formal development of the valley from the Battleford's River Valley Masterplan has just begun but the potential is limitless.
